About this piece

A modern introspective work characterized by a minimalist approach and layered musical textures. It is unique for its subtle, evolving harmonic shifts that create a sense of persistent, unresolved tension.

What makes it challenging

At Henle 4 this is an intermediate piece that expects secure technique and real attention to phrasing. The main demands: a true singing tone, with the melody floating above the accompaniment; several simultaneous layers, each needing its own dynamic level; and rubato that must breathe naturally without losing the pulse.

Teacher notes

Maintaining the consistency of the layered texture throughout the piece requires excellent finger control.

Frequently asked questions

How hard is Fail better by Tiago Morais Morgado?

Fail better is rated Henle level 4 of 9 — intermediate repertoire, roughly ABRSM grades 5–6. In the RCM system it corresponds to about level 5.

What level do I need to play Fail better?

You should be comfortable at Henle level 4 — meaning you can already play level 3–4 pieces cleanly. Learning it one level early is possible as a stretch piece, but more than that usually leads to months of frustration.

How long is Fail better?

A typical performance of Fail better lasts about 4 minutes.
